Warning Signs You Need Structural Repair After Water Damage

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Our team has seen it all, and we’re here to help you identify the warning signs of structural damage after water dam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ice persistent musty odors in your home, it may be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these odors – they can show a more serious issue that needs immediate attention.

Cracks in Walls and Ceilings

Cracks in your walls and ceilings can be a sign of structural damage. If you notice any new or worsening cracks, it’s essential to have your home inspected by a professional.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on your ceilings and walls can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these stains – they can lead to more extensive damage if left unchecked.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or structural compromise.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to have it inspected by a professional.

Unusual Sounds or Squeaks

Unusual sounds or squeaks in your home can be a sign of structural damage or settling. Don’t ignore these sounds – they can show a more serious issue that needs attention.

Water Damage in Your Crawlspace or Attic

Water damage in your crawlspace or attic can be a sign of a more extensive issue. Don’t ignore these areas – they can lead to further damage if left unchecked.

Structural Repair After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No DIY repairs are often enough for small, contained leaks.
Water damage in a large area or multiple rooms No Yes Professional help is necessary to ensure thorough drying and repair.
Structural damage or compromised integrity No Yes Structural damage needs professional attention to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Hidden water damage or musty odors No Yes Hidden damage needs professional detection and repair to prevent further issues.
High-pressure water removal or specialized equipment No Yes High-pressure water removal and specialized equipment need professional expertise.
Insurance claims or complex paperwork No Yes Insurance claims and complex paperwork need professional guidance and support.
